Horizon Quantum Mechanics for spheroidal sources

Abstract
We start investigating the extension of the Horizon Quantum Mechanics to the case of spheroidal sources. We first study the location of trapping surfaces in space-times resulting from an axial deformation of static isotropic systems, and show that the Misner-Sharp mass evaluated on the corresponding undeformed spherically symmetric space provides the correct gravitational radius to locate the horizon. We finally propose a way to determine the deformation parameter in the quantum theory.
